Wine, Art and Taste is a food and wine event developed in 4 stages and dedicated to the Emilia-Romagna territory. Each evening four wines will be tasted, accompanied by a musician and local gastronomic products. Slow Food producers will be present, presented by Leila Salimbeni, journalist and food and wine critic
The four stages will be:
- Saturday 20 April - Bologna: the bucolic Colli Bolognesi, with the products of the countryside, their wine in four interpretations and the folklore of Ivan Di Dia on violin.
- Saturday 27 April - Modena and Reggio: the urbanity of Lambrusco. Airy and spontaneous wines to be appreciated with the artefacts of the Emilian territory and together with the flute tunes of Clara Cocco.
- Saturday 4 May 2024 - Imola: an underrated great white, always up-to-date and always at ease, Albana. Accompanying it, Maestro Giancarlo Aquilini's piano and a basket of fruit and vegetables.
- Saturday 11 May 2024 - Romagna: a land of the Riviera, close to the Apennines, where Sangiovese, a lyrical and profound grape variety like Luca Piazzi's trumpet, lives, and the Romagna table, suspended between the countryside and the sea.
